Effect of photobiomodulation on pain level during local anesthesia injection: a randomized clinical trial
Sholeh Ghabraei1, Behnam Bolhari2, Hasan Mohammad Nashtaie3
1Associate Professor, Endodontic Department, School of Dentistry, Tehran University of Medical Sciences, Tehran, Iran.
Abstract:
The aim of this study was to investigate the effect of photobiomodulation therapy (PBMT) as pre-treatment on pain level during injection in the anterior maxillary region. 56 Patients were randomly divided into 3 groups, Group 1:980 nm diode laser (n = 22) (experimental), Group 2:980 nm diode laser probe placed in vestibule without radiation (placebo) (n = 22), Group3: no pre-treatment before injection (n = 12) (control). Pain level during injection was evaluated by visual analog scale (VAS). The severity of pain in Group 1(experimental) and Group 2 (placebo) was significantly lower than Group 3 (control). Group 1 had a lesser pain level than Group 2, but the difference in pain level between them was not significant. PBMT with 980 nm wavelength decreased pain level during local anesthesia injection without superiority over placebo.
